SUMMARY:
The FAA is adopting a new airworthiness directive (AD) for all Rolls-Royce Deutschland Ltd & Co KG (RRD) Model RB211-Trent 800 engines. This AD is prompted by reports of cracks on certain intermediate-pressure compressor (IPC) rotor shaft balance lands. This AD requires initial and repetitive on-wing or in-shop borescope inspections (BSIs) of certain IPC rotor shaft balance lands for cracks, dents, and nicks, and replacement of the IPC rotor shaft if necessary, and would prohibit the installation of a certain IPC rotor shaft on any engine, as specified in a European Union Aviation Safety Agency (EASA) AD, which is incorporated by reference (IBR). The FAA is issuing this AD to address the unsafe condition on these products.

Background
The FAA issued a notice of proposed rulemaking (NPRM) to amend 14 CFR part 39 by adding an AD that would apply to all RRD Model RB211-Trent 800 engines. The NPRM published in the Federal Register on September 15, 2023 (88 FR 63539); corrected on September 27, 2023 (88 FR 66314). The NPRM was prompted by EASA AD 2023-0040, dated February 16, 2023 (EASA AD 2023-0040) (also referred to as the MCAI), issued by EASA, which is the Technical Agent for the Member States of the European Union. The MCAI states that cracking on the IPC rotor shaft balance land has been historically observed on RRD Model RB211-Trent 800 engines. To address this unsafe condition, the manufacturer developed a modification, which introduced a revised balancing method that removed the original balancing weights from the IPC rotor shaft, and published service information to provide instructions for in-service modification. In addition, the manufacturer published service information to provide instructions for in-shop eddy current (EC) inspection of the IPC rotor shaft balance land. Consequently, EASA issued EASA AD 2014-0152, dated June 20, 2014; corrected June 25, 2014; revised March 2, 2018 (EASA AD 2014-0152R1).
Since EASA issued EASA AD 2014-0152R1, the manufacturer determined that certain RB211-Trent 800 engines were not inspected during engine refurbishment. The manufacturer then identified the IPC rotor shaft balance lands that were not inspected and published service information that describes procedures to perform a BSI of the IPC rotor shaft balance land until the in-shop EC inspection is accomplished. To address this, EASA issued the MCAI.
In the NPRM, the FAA proposed to require initial and repetitive on-wing or in-shop BSIs of certain IPC rotor shaft balance lands for cracks, dents, and nicks, and replacement of the IPC rotor shaft if necessary, and proposed to prohibit the installation of a certain IPC rotor shaft on any engine. Related Service Information Under 1 CFR Part 51
The FAA reviewed EASA AD 2023-0040, which specifies procedures for performing initial and repetitive on-wing or in-shop BSIs of the IPC rotor shaft balance land for cracks, dents, and nicks, and replacing the IPC rotor shaft if necessary. The MCAI also specifies prohibiting the installation of a certain IPC rotor shaft on any engine and that accomplishing an in-shop EC inspection of the IPC rotor shaft balance land or replacing the IPC rotor shaft constitutes as terminating action for the repetitive BSIs.

Costs of Compliance
The FAA estimates that this AD affects 194 engines installed on airplanes of U.S. registry.
The FAA estimates the following costs to comply with this AD:
Action | Labor cost | Parts cost | Cost per product | Cost on U.S. operators |
---|---|---|---|---|
BSI of IPC rotor shaft balance land | 4.5 work-hours × $85 per hour = $382.50 | $0 | $382.50 | $74,205 |
The FAA estimates the following costs to do any necessary replacements that would be required based on the results of the inspection. The agency has no way of determining the number of aircraft that might need these replacements:
Action | Labor cost | Parts cost | Cost per product |
---|---|---|---|
Replace IPC rotor shaft | 50 work-hours × $85 per hour = $4,250 | $2,123,908 | $2,128,158 |

(c) Applicability
This AD applies to Rolls-Royce Deutschland Ltd & Co KG (RRD) Model RB211-Trent 875-17, RB211-Trent 877-17, RB211-Trent 884-17, RB211-Trent 884B-17, RB211-Trent 892-17, RB211-Trent 892B-17, and RB211-Trent 895-17 engines.
(d) Subject
Joint Aircraft System Component (JASC) Code 7230, Turbine Engine Compressor Section.
(e) Unsafe Condition
This AD was prompted by reports of cracks on the intermediate-pressure compressor (IPC) rotor shaft balance land. The FAA is issuing this AD to detect cracks on the IPC rotor shaft balance land. The unsafe condition, if not addressed, could lead to IPC rotor shaft failure and consequent uncontained high-energy debris, resulting in damage to the airplane.
